Greeting
A knock on the door. Uneven, like the person outside is hesitating. "Open up! I know you're in there!" The door creaks open. A guy stands on the doorstep - messy blue-and-gold suit, a ridiculous pom-pom beanie. He immediately stumbles, catching himself on the doorframe. "Damn it..." He straightens up, frowns, crosses his arms. "I came for you." A pause. He looks at you… and falters slightly. "You’re the former Number One." Quieter now, the forced roughness slipping: "Make me stronger." Even quieter: "Please..."
